Output 5fb5451cb797d26c753f051b9ee3caa08abc3cbb638b2579386fc81e9981758a:1

value
2489296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f3daeef4caff9b6cf49cb01277b80f98aeabc16 OP_EQUAL
address
3EkQSospgsfVc5N5H3XdcMt5nHrKbYenCD
transaction
5fb5451cb797d26c753f051b9ee3caa08abc3cbb638b2579386fc81e9981758a
spent
true